Listen to your friend or relative's feelings, Alternatives are available, talk about those, Do not promise confidentiality, you may need to call for urgent help, Remove any means the person has to complete or attempt suicide, Call the Samaritans (08457-90-90-90), Breathing Space (0800-83-85-87) or 999 if in an emergency, DO bring the person to a calm environment, DO remember that people my recall what has happened when they are well even though they appear to be out of touch with reality at the time of the incident, DON'T try and talk a person out of their feelings - they are very real to them, DO stay with the person and listen (if safe for you), DON'T assume that everything a person says is the result of a delusion. Mental Health Officers offer a variety of duties under appropriate mental health legislation, including specialist assessments under the Mental Health (Care & Treatment) (Scotland) Act 2003 and the Adults with Incapacity (Scotland) Act 2000. The Crisis Assessment & Home Treatment Service is a community based service providing crisis mental health assessment for tangata whaiora who require an urgent response and are likely to require the support of community or inpatient mental health services. Community mental health teams (CMHTs) CMHTs support people with mental health problems living in the community, and also their carers.
